Health Insurance Portability and Accountability Act
The Health Insurance Portability and Accountability Act (HIPAA) stands as a cornerstone in maintaining patient privacy and confidentiality. Enacted in 1996, HIPAA provides national standards for protecting sensitive patient data. This legislation primarily influences healthcare providers, insurance companies, and their business associates, requiring them to implement safeguards for electronic health information.
One significant aspect of HIPAA is the Privacy Rule, which regulates the use and disclosure of protected health information (PHI). Organizations must obtain an individual's consent before sharing their health data. Moreover, the Security Rule under HIPAA mandates that organizations employ administrative, physical, and technical safeguards to ensure the confidentiality, integrity, and availability of electronic health information.
The implications of HIPAA for digital health are profound. With the rise of telehealth platforms and mobile health applications, compliance with HIPAA ensures trust in technology. Stakeholders must be aware of the potential penalties for violations, which significantly impact organizations and their reputation.
General Data Protection Regulation
The General Data Protection Regulation (GDPR) forms a critical component of the legal landscape in Europe when it comes to data protection. Effective since 2018, GDPR sets stringent rules for data collection, processing, and sharing involving European citizens. Unlike HIPAA, which is limited to the United States, GDPR has a broad application, affecting any entity handling the data of EU citizens regardless of their geographical location.
GDPR emphasizes the principles of transparency, data minimization, and accountability. Organizations must inform individuals about how their data is used and allow them to access and erase their personal information upon request. Moreover, organizations are liable for data breaches, requiring prompt notification to affected individuals and authorities.
For digital health providers, understanding GDPR is crucial. Non-compliance can lead to hefty fines, in some cases up to 4% of global annual revenue. Consequently, digital health solutions must be designed with privacy by design, a notable principle embedded in GDPR, ensuring effective user consent and data management practices from the outset.
Federal Food, Drug, and Cosmetic Act
The Federal Food, Drug, and Cosmetic Act (FDCA) plays a significant role in the regulation of medical devices, therapies, and other health-related products in the United States. Established in 1938, the FDCA authorizes the Food and Drug Administration (FDA) to oversee the safety and efficacy of medical products.
In recent years, the FDA has extended its oversight to include software and apps classified as medical devices. Companies developing digital health technologies must navigate FDCA regulations to ensure their products meet established safety standards before going to market.
Additionally, the FDCA imposes strict compliance guidelines concerning marketing claims. Organizations must ensure that promotional materials do not mislead consumers about the intended use and effectiveness of their products.
In the context of digital health, understanding FDCA is vital. As many digital health interventions are considered medical devices, stakeholders must ensure their solutions comply with FDA regulations to avoid legal ramifications and foster credibility among users.

Licensing and Practice Regulations
Licensing is a fundamental aspect of telemedicine that presents significant legal challenges. Physicians typically must hold licenses in the states where their patients reside. This requirement varies by jurisdiction and can complicate telehealth provision. The underlying principle is to ensure that practitioners meet local medical standards. The Interstate Medical Licensure Compact is one effort to streamline this process, allowing for a multi-state license in participating states. However, not all states are part of this agreement. Therefore, providers may still face barriers that limit their capacity to offer services across state lines.
Practices using telemedicine must also navigate regulations concerning consultations, prescriptions, and continuity of care. Compliance necessitates understanding and adapting to different state laws as well as ensuring that technology used adheres to privacy requirements. The evolving nature of telehealth regulations often leads to uncertainty, making it imperative for practitioners to stay abreast of changes affecting their practice.
Reimbursement Issues
Reimbursement for telemedicine services is another critical legal challenge. Historically, many insurance companies were hesitant to cover telehealth visits. However, recent changes, particularly spurred by the COVID-19 pandemic, resulted in expanded coverage. Both public and private insurers now offer more comprehensive reimbursement policies for telemedicine services.
Despite progress, many hurdles remain. Coverage can vary significantly across states and insurance plans, creating a complex landscape for healthcare providers. Some insurers may still demand that telehealth services be equivalent to in-person visits in terms of diagnosis and treatment, affecting how providers approach care delivery.
Furthermore, certain services may not be reimbursable, leading to questions about the viability of telemedicine in some scenarios. To qualify for reimbursement, providers often must meet specific documentation and procedural requirements, further complicating the financial landscape.

Wearable Devices and Monitoring Systems
Wearable devices such as fitness trackers and smartwatches have surged in popularity. These devices gather data about physical activity, heart rates, and other health metrics. Compliance for these technologies centers on how they collect and process personal data.
Manufacturers must ensure that their products comply with data protection laws, which vary by region. For instance, the General Data Protection Regulation (GDPR) in the European Union mandates transparency in data processing. Companies must outline what data they collect and why.
Important compliance aspects include:
- Data Minimization: Only collect the data that is necessary for specified purposes.
- User Control: Users should have access to their data and the ability to correct or delete it.
- Health Claims: Any health-related claims made by the device must be substantiated and compliant with relevant regulations.
Wearable devices also face scrutiny when functioning as medical devices. Their classification determines the level of regulatory oversight required.
Understanding these compliance factors is critical for developers, manufacturers, and health professionals to mitigate legal risks while enhancing patient trust in digital health offerings.

Emerging Technologies and Regulatory Adaptation
In recent years, we have seen rapid advancements in digital health technologies. Artificial intelligence, blockchain, and telemedicine have surged in popularity and application. These innovations promise improved patient outcomes and efficiencies but also pose significant legal questions concerning their implementation.
- Artificial Intelligence: AI in healthcare is being used for diagnostics, treatment recommendations, and patient management systems. The law must adapt to ensure accountability in AI-driven decisions. Questions arise about liability when AI errors occur.
- Blockchain: This technology provides potential solutions to data security and patient consent issues. Blockchain's decentralized nature can enhance transparency and traceability in patient data management. However, regulatory frameworks must evolve to address its unique challenges, such as data permanence and consent revocation.
- Telemedicine: The COVID-19 pandemic accelerated the adoption of telehealth services. As this method gains traction, legal frameworks must properly regulate licensing and reimbursement issues to ensure both practitioners and patients can navigate this territory safely.
Regulatory bodies are recognizing the need for flexible, adaptive laws to keep pace with these technologies. Engaging stakeholders in discussions will be crucial for developing effective standards that encapsulate both innovation and protection.
